Web17 mei 2024 · Select the Mailings tab on the Ribbon. In the Create group, select Envelopes to display the Envelopes and Labels dialog box. In the Delivery address field, enter the recipient’s address. In the Return address field, enter the sender’s address. Check the Omit box when you don’t want to print a return address on the envelope. Web12 mrt. 2024 · 2. Lick the envelope. Swipe your tongue carefully across the seal of the envelope. 3.
